Temporary storage often means that you just need a place to store things and don’t necessarily care about manoeuvring space. How do you plan to use your storage space?Īre you looking for temporary storage with the space you are renting, or is this long term? With long term storage, you may want to be able to move about in the unit – add or take away things at different times. This will give you a way to visualise what you are placing in storage. Also make a note of all the irregular shaped items that you have – bicycles, machinery like lawn mowers, decorative lamps and unboxed appliances such as bread makers and air fryers. This includes large items like furniture, the number of boxed items you will have – from toys, to books to appliances and the dreaded kitchen stuff. No matter the size of the home you are putting away in storage, first make an inventory of everything that you are putting in.
